Professor Alsmith looks at changes in self-esteem across adolescence by measuring the self-esteem of 11 year olds, 13 year olds,

15 year olds, and 17 year olds and comparing the results between the groups. This is an example of a(n) _________.a. correlational study
b. cross-sectional study
c. archival study
d. longitudinal study

Answer: b. Cross-sectional study

Explanation:

A. Correlational study is a research design in which a researcher seeks to find out if two or more variables are related and if so, then in what way. An example is difference in people's height,

B. Cross-sectional study is a type of study that involves observing a population or representative subset at a particular point in time and analysing the data. An example is evaluating people from different ages.

C. Archival study involves seeking out and retrieving evidence from archival records.

D. Longitudinal study involves gathering data from observing the same individuals repeatedly over a period of time.
